Output 8883a45ec414675492382f6d37ffe42e81f17ecc9fc60c2467a5809bd834de2e:30

value
1422636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e78993187c0473063fdafaba999d644d8ff81b6 OP_EQUAL
address
35vjUh7tb1cRcg9GbDwszM8jcpGSjFhE4E
transaction
8883a45ec414675492382f6d37ffe42e81f17ecc9fc60c2467a5809bd834de2e
spent
true